Output bdaa3105632a952e99036881c183b5508a687541c8a613765cc03d90e25b9196:98

value
40760
script pubkey
OP_0 OP_PUSHBYTES_20 12475515573f75904b881b9e0f92ca4458ae3618
address
bc1qzfr4292h8a6eqjugrw0qlyk2g3v2udscawpnfk
transaction
bdaa3105632a952e99036881c183b5508a687541c8a613765cc03d90e25b9196